Subject: Your locker in the changing rooms

Hi there,

Welcome to the Brindlemoor site! Quick note from the front desk: you've been assigned a locker in the east changing room, second row, near the showers. Bring your own padlock if you want extra security, though the built-in keypad works fine for most folks. Lockers get cleared out every Friday evening, so don't leave anything over the weekend. Towels are on the shelf by the door. To open your locker and the changing-room door, use the code below.

Cheers,
Front Desk, Ostermill Labs

door code, yagap-bahof: bdg-O-05

Quick note on visitors to the Brightbox recording studio: anyone filming training videos needs to be signed in at the facilities desk and walked up personally — no sending folks up on their own, please, since the studio shares a corridor with the edit suites. Give them a day badge and remind them the studio door re-locks after 30 seconds. The keypad code they'll need is:

badge for hahip-bagag: bdg-FIJ-9

**Q: A customer says our fonts look wrong — do we pull them from the vendor's servers?**

Nope! At Brindlehop we vendor all third-party fonts into the Typecask bundle, so there's no external fetch to break. If glyphs look off, it's almost always a stale app cache on their end. Ask them to hard-refresh first. The step-by-step checklist for font issues is on the page below.

dashboard of yahaf-kajep = https://jira.zemvarsys.internal/display/projects/browse/browse/a08b

Welcome to the Cartwheel logistics team. Our main service is Pickpath, the warehouse pick-list optimizer that sequences orders across the Dunmore fulfillment floor. Pickpath reroutes pickers in real time, so outages directly slow shipping. Your first week covers the scoring model and the zone map editor. Before you can run the local simulator, you'll need to unlock the encrypted fixtures bundle in the dev environment. The bundle unlocks with the recovery passphrase provided below.

strongbox words: prawyn-fenmir